Job description

We're looking for an Engineering Manager to own AI at one of the fastest-growing AI legal tech companies in Europe. Over 2,000 lawyers use JUPUS every day, and the AI behind it is already in production and already in front of customers. You'd own the team, the technical roadmap, and the standard everything gets built to.

You'll report to our Head of Engineering and lead our AI team. This is a leadership role, not a senior engineering seat with a lead title. You won't be shipping features yourself, and that's deliberate- we want someone whose leverage comes from the team they build and the calls they make.

Your Challenge and Opportunity in This Role

Legal work is document-heavy, judgement-heavy, and almost untouched by AI. We've trained on over a million German court rulings and handled over a million cases, so the hard part isn't proving AI belongs here. The hard part is doing it well enough that a lawyer will put their professional judgement behind the output.

Your job is to make that repeatable. The field throws up something new every week and most of it is noise. We need someone who can tell the difference, turn that judgement into a roadmap, and build a team that can actually deliver it.

Tasks

Leading the team

  • Make the team better than you found it: hire, mentor, and raise the bar on what good looks like here. Your impact shows up in what they ship when you're not in the room.

  • Set the engineering standard for AI work: evaluation, testing and observability, and a delivery rhythm that holds up when the pressure is on.

  • Own delivery at startup pace, without trading away the accuracy lawyers depend on.

Direction and roadmap

  • Own the technical roadmap: architecture, agent frameworks, retrieval, evaluation and observability. You won't be writing the code, but you will be the person who says whether the design is right.

  • Partner with product on what gets built: product owns the product roadmap, you own what is technically possible and what it will actually cost.

  • Separate signal from noise: track how generative and agentic AI is actually evolving, and turn it into decisions rather than slide decks.

Across the company

  • Get AI into real product workflows, working with design and engineering so it lands as something people use rather than something we demo.

  • Make the rest of the business better at AI. You're the authority here, and the goal is that other teams get sharper because you're in the building.

  • Explain AI to people who don't build it, from engineers to the CEO, without dumbing it down or hiding behind it.

Requirements

Leadership

  • You've run an engineering team and made it better. Direct reports, and specific examples of people who levelled up under you.

  • You get results through people who don't report to you: product managers, domain experts, other teams.

  • You've led at pace, on high-performing teams with real deadlines, and you know what to cut.

AI Depth

  • At least 3 years at a company where generative or agentic AI is central to the product, not bolted onto it.

  • Teams you've led have shipped agentic systems to production. Prototypes and demos don't count.

  • You can hold your own on the detail: retrieval quality, evaluation, observability, agent design. You recognise an over-engineered solution when you see one.

Further Requirements

  • Located within CET +/-2.

  • Nice to have: a formal background in AI or ML, experience taking a product from non-AI-native to AI-native, familiarity with LangGraph, MCP, LangSmith or Langfuse, or legal tech and other regulated domains.
